What to check before for buildings near transit in Little Italy

  • Expect easy access to public transportation options.
  • Confirm amenities and maintenance policies before signing any lease.
  • Check for any building fees and restrictions that may apply.
  • Investigate the building's track record in terms of tenant experiences and reviews.
  • Consider nearby conveniences like grocery stores, restaurants, and parks.
